No. 24 Rollins out-hits LSSU




March 4, 2008

WINTER PARK, Fla. - No. 24-ranked Rollins out-hit LSSU 16-5 to win Monday's softball double-header against Lake Superior State, 6-0 and 4-2.

Katie Brandt had LSSU's only hit in the shutout loss. Lake State pitcher Nikki Christensen gave up four earned runs on eight hits, three walks and three strikeouts.

Lake Superior State scored one run in the top of the fourth inning to snap a 0-0 deadlock during the nightcap, but Rollins (5-8) answered with three runs in the bottom of the fifth and one in the sixth. LSSU scored its final run in the top of the seventh.

Katie Brandt and Nichole Dunford had doubles for LSSU (2-4) in the nightcap. April Brandt added a single, and Amber Kern had the Lakers' lone RBI.

Laker pitcher Stephanie Reveley gave up four earned runs on eight hits, one walk and one strikeout.

The Lakers play 13th-ranked Grand Valley State (3-1) at 11 a.m. and Assumption at 3 p.m. today in Ocoee, Fla. The same teams also met on Sunday with GVSU winning 11-1 and LSSU beating Assumption, 5-3.
